H Type Scaffolding Frame

H frame scaffolding is a type of scaffolding system that consists of vertical H-shaped frames connected by horizontal and diagonal braces. This type of scaffolding is commonly used in construction, maintenance, and repair projects to provide a stable and secure working platform for workers at elevated heights.H frame scaffolding is made of steel tubes, which are lightweight yet strong enough to support heavy loads. The frames are designed to interlock with one another, creating a sturdy structure that can be easily assembled and disassembled. The horizontal and diagonal braces are used to provide additional support and stability to the scaffolding system.

Types of H Type Scaffolding Frame
 

Walk-Through Frames
Walk-through frames are engineered with a large open span between vertical posts, allowing workers to move freely through the scaffolding without ducking or navigating around horizontal bars. This design streamlines the workflow for façade work and continuous movement along building exteriors. It’s particularly useful in tasks such as plastering, painting, and cladding, where mobility is crucial.

 

Snap-On Frames
Snap-on frames utilize specialized snap-lock or pin-and-clip mechanisms that enable quick connection and disconnection of horizontal and vertical members. These frames are ideal for projects that require frequent relocation or reconfiguration of scaffolding. Their tool-free setup enhances speed and efficiency, especially on short-term or fast-paced job sites.

 

Mason Frames
Mason frames are optimized for masonry work, featuring fewer horizontal cross members at the working level to reduce interference. This gives masons unobstructed access to brick, block, or stonework, improving productivity and ergonomics. These frames also support heavy materials typically used in masonry tasks.

 

Single-Width and Double-Width Frames
Single-width frames are compact and best suited for narrow spaces or indoor applications. Double-width frames offer a wider working platform that accommodates multiple workers, materials, and tools, enhancing productivity on large-scale or exterior projects. The choice between the two depends on access space and the number of personnel working simultaneously.

 

Ladder Frames
Ladder frames include integrated vertical rungs or steps built into the frame structure, eliminating the need for separate ladders. This built-in access system ensures safety and efficiency when moving between scaffold levels. Ladder frames are ideal for multi-story projects or when frequent vertical movement is required.

Components of H Type Scaffolding Frame

H Frame: This forms the backbone of the scaffolding system. It consists of two vertical frames connected by horizontal cross braces, creating the distinctive "H" shape. These frames provide vertical support and stability to the entire structure.

 

Cross Bracing: Cross braces are horizontal bars that connect the two vertical frames of the H Frame Scaffolding. They play a crucial role in maintaining the structural integrity of the scaffold by preventing lateral movement and sway. They are typically placed diagonally, forming an 'X' pattern.

Single Bracing

Single braces are additional horizontal bars that further reinforce the structure. They are placed horizontally between the vertical frames, providing additional stability to the scaffolding system.

Plan Bracing

Plan bracing, also known as horizontal bracing, runs parallel to the working platform. It connects the vertical frames, ensuring the stability of the scaffold and providing support to the working surface. This type of bracing helps distribute weight evenly across the scaffold.

Tie Bracing

Tie bracing serves to connect the scaffold to the building or structure it is being used against. It prevents the scaffold from swaying or leaning away from the building, enhancing stability and safety. Properly secured tie bracing is crucial for the overall safety of the scaffold.

Assembling and Using H Type Scaffolding Frame Safely

Site Preparation: Begin by surveying the worksite to identify potential hazards or obstructions. Use a leveling tool to confirm even ground conditions and install base plates or adjustable jacks to accommodate minor slope variations. Ensure drainage or moisture issues are addressed to maintain a solid foundation.

 

Frame Positioning: Stand the H-frames upright at intervals corresponding to the scaffold’s intended width and height. Use a spirit level or plumb line to check vertical alignment. Secure frames in place with base jacks or fixed anchor points to prevent shifting during use.

 

Bracing: Connect diagonal cross braces between vertical H-frames to create X-shaped stabilizers. Begin at the base and work upwards, locking braces into designated slots or couplers. Install horizontal ledgers across each bay to reinforce the structure and prepare mounting points for platforms.

 

Platform Placement: Lay scaffold planks or metal decks across the ledgers, ensuring even distribution and secure fit. Confirm that each platform is free from damage, properly supported, and fastened if needed. Incorporate toe boards at platform edges to prevent tool or material slippage.

 

Safety Additions: Mount guardrails at all exposed edges to prevent falls. Install internal ladders or use ladder frames to allow safe ascent and descent between levels. Check all connections for tightness and compliance with site safety protocols before authorizing scaffold use.

 

Safety Precautions

 

 
 

Always wear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)

This includes hard hats, safety harnesses, gloves, high-visibility vests, and non-slip safety boots. Fall arrest systems should be used where required.

 
 

Respect Load Limits

Never overload platforms with excessive weight. Consider both personnel and materials when calculating total load. Use reinforced platforms for heavy-duty tasks.

 
 

Conduct Daily Inspections

Check for loose fittings, damaged frames, or worn platforms each day before use. Inspections should also occur after any severe weather or site modifications.

 
 

Proper Anchoring and Tie-Backs

Use wall ties or anchors to secure scaffolding to the structure, especially for tall or multi-level assemblies. This prevents tipping or swaying under wind or dynamic loads.

 
 

Train All Personnel

Ensure all workers are trained on assembly, usage, fall protection protocols, and emergency response procedures. Supervisors should be qualified to inspect and approve scaffold setups.

 
 

Maintain Clear Access

Do not obstruct ladders or platform paths. Keep materials organized and ensure emergency exits are accessible.

 
 

Use Edge Protection

Guardrails, midrails, and toe boards must be installed on all open sides of elevated platforms to prevent falls and falling objects.

 
 

Weather Awareness

Avoid using scaffolding during high winds, storms, or icy conditions. Always cover or secure materials in bad weather. wear PPE (hard hats, harnesses, gloves).
